July,24,2016:

Six of 30 names suggested were rejected by SC Collegium for Madras High Court.

Supreme Court Collegium has now cleared 24 names of Justices to join at Madras High Court. This includes 15 Justices from the Bar and 9 from the Bench on Promotion.

The names clearedby the Supreme Court Collegium are: . Parthiban,  M. Govindaraj, M. Sundar, R. Sureshkumar, Bhavani Subbaroyan, A.D. Jagdish Chandra, Sathia Chandran, G.R. Swaminathan, Abdul Quddhose, R. Subrama-niam, M. Dhandapani, P.D. Audikesavalu,  Anita Sumanth VNishaBanu, M.S. Ramesh, and S.M. Subramanaiam.

The nine district judges whose names have been cleared for elevation are: S. Baskaran, P. Velmur-ugan, G. Jayachandran, R.M.T. Teeka Raman, N. Sathishkumar, N. Sesha-sayee, T. Ravindran,  C.V. Karthikeyan and Basheer Ahmed.

The SC Collegium reportedly cleared the names in its meeting held on Friday, last week.

Total names sent by the Madras High Court had sent 30 names. Out of them six has been now rejected by the SC collegium.

As of now there are 38 judges in Madras High Court. A total of 37 vacancies are available for appointment.

In yet another related development, Central Government has have acceded to the suggestions by the Supreme Court Collegium to transfer four High Court Judges.

According to report received from sources, Justice F A Ansari will join as Patna High Court Chief Justice.

Chief Justice of Andhra Pradesh and Telengana Justice D B Bhosle will join as Chief Justice of Allahabad High Court.

Justice Indira Banerjee of Calcutta High Court has been transferred to Delhi High Court.

Justice M M Shantanagoudar of Karnataka High Court has been moved to the High Court of Kerala.

Acting Chief Justice of Punjab and Haryana High Court S J Wajifdar has been directed to act as Chief Justice of the same court.
